Selecting materials are essential for achieving your goals
Deciding on the right selections is essential for a custom deck design, as it directly controls both aesthetics and durability. The choice between wood, composite, and PVC can greatly influence the overall look and longevity of the deck. Natural wood offers aesthetic warmth and attractiveness but requires regular preservation to prevent rot and weathering. In contrast, composite materials provide a more robust option, resisting fading and staining while requiring less upkeep. Additionally, environmentally friendly choices are becoming increasingly popular, appealing to homeowners focused on sustainability. The material selected also impacts costs, with each type presenting different price points. Ultimately, thoughtful material selection contributes to a deck that not only complements the outdoor space but also stands the test of time.

Important Strategies to Preserve Your Bespoke Deck
Maintaining a bespoke deck demands regular attention to guarantee its longevity and look. Homeowners should start by cleaning the deck often to eliminate dirt, debris, and mold. A mild scrub with soap and water, or a specialized deck cleaner, often works well. It's also necessary to inspect the deck for any signs of wear, such as loose boards or rusted nails, which should be handled promptly to prevent additional damage.
Sealing the deck every few years is crucial to protect it from dampness and UV damage. Different materials may require particular sealants, so seeking expert advice can be beneficial. Additionally, routine sweeping and removing snow or debris in winter will help maintain its condition. Finally, placing furniture pads under heavy items can prevent marks and dents, keeping the deck looking pristine. Consistent maintenance guarantees the deck remains a beautiful and functional outdoor space for years to come.

Which Materials Work Best for Different Climates?
Timber options like cedar thrive in temperate climates, while composite materials withstand moisture in humid areas. In regions with extreme temperatures, aluminum offers strength, and treated lumber provides protection against pests and weathering.

Are Permits Essential for Custom Deck Building?
Yes, authorizations are typically required for custom deck construction. Regulations vary by locality, so it's essential for house owners to check with community officials to validate compliance with zoning requirements and building codes before launching the initiative.
